Event Series StoryWalk

StoryWalk

Mouat Park

StoryWalk® is a self-guided supported-activity that allows children and adults to enjoy reading and outdoor activity at the same time. Event Series Youth Games

Youth Games

Community Program Room 129 McPhillips Avenue, Salt Spring Island, BC

Starting in November for youth aged 9-13, join us in the Library’s Community Program Room for an afternoon of games with your friends. Snacks provided, play the games you’d like! One teen will be present to monitor/facilitate as needed, but this afternoon is for playing boardgames of your choosing. Drop-in, open 2-4PM.
